Unit Definitions

What is Kilobyte ?

A Kilobyte (kB) is a decimal unit of digital information that is equal to 1000 bytes (or 8,000 bits) and commonly used to express the size of a file or the amount of memory used by a program. It is also used to express data transfer speeds and in the context of data storage and memory, the binary-based unit of kibibyte (KiB) is used instead.

What is Exabyte ?

An Exabyte (EB) is a decimal unit of measurement for digital information storage. It is equal to 1,000,000,000,000,000,000 (one quintillion) bytes, It is commonly used to measure the storage capacity of large data centers, computer hard drives, flash drives, and other digital storage devices.
